Robert F. Paulson is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Physiology and Immunology. According to data from OpenAlex, Robert F. Paulson has authored 78 papers receiving a total of 3.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 37 papers in Molecular Biology, 26 papers in Physiology and 25 papers in Immunology. Recurrent topics in Robert F. Paulson's work include Erythrocyte Function and Pathophysiology (25 papers), Immune Cell Function and Interaction (11 papers) and Hemoglobinopathies and Related Disorders (10 papers). Robert F. Paulson is often cited by papers focused on Erythrocyte Function and Pathophysiology (25 papers), Immune Cell Function and Interaction (11 papers) and Hemoglobinopathies and Related Disorders (10 papers). Robert F. Paulson collaborates with scholars based in United States, Canada and Myanmar. Robert F. Paulson's co-authors include John M. Perry, Omid F. Harandi, K. Sandeep Prabhu, Alan Bernstein, Shailaja Hegde, Lei Shi, Prashanth Porayette, Laurie Lenox, Chang Liao and Pamela H. Correll and has published in prestigious journals such as Cell,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ences and Journal of Biological Chemistry.
